SERIAL INTERFACING
Communication with the microcontroller can occur via a
clock-synchronized serial peripheral interface. It is
possible to select two different 3-line (SPI and serial
interface) or a 4-line SPI interface. Selection is done via
the PS[1:0] inputs.
9.1
Serial peripheral interface
The Serial Peripheral Interface (SPI) is a 3-line or 4-line
interface for communication between the microcontroller
and the LCD driver chip. Three lines are common to both
3-line and 4-line SPI, these are SCE (chip enable), SCLK
(serial clock) and SDATA (serial data). For the 4-line SPI a
separate D/C line is added. The OM6208 is connected to
the serial data I/O of the microcontroller by pads SDATA
(data input) and SDO (data output) connected together.
9.1.1
W
RITE MODE
The display data/command indication may be controlled
by software or by the D/C select pin. When the D/C pad is
used, display data is transmitted when D/C is HIGH, and
command data is transmitted when D/C is LOW (see
Figs 10 and 11). When D/C is not used, the ‘display data
length’instructionisusedtoindicatethataspecificnumber
of display data bytes (1 to 255) are to be transmitted (see
Fig.11). The next byte after the display data string is
handled as an instruction command.
When the 3-line SPI interface is used the display
data/command is controlled by software (see Fig.12).
If SCE is pulled high during a serial display data stream,
the interrupted byte is invalid data but all previously
transmitted data is valid. The next byte received will be
handled as an instruction command (see Fig.13).
